  • Process for the manufacture of poly(hydrocarbylene aryl phosphate)compositions
    申请人:Akzo Nobel N.V.
    公开号:EP0613902A1
    公开(公告)日:1994-09-07
    Arylene poly(diarylphosphate) compositions can be formed by a process which comprises: (a) forming a reaction mixture comprising diaryl halophosphate and, as by-products, a mixture of monoaryl dihalophosphate and triarylphosphate, by reaction of phosphorus oxyhalide and a phenol in a first reactor; (b) if a preponderance of lower oligomers is desired, optionally transferring the reaction mixture from (a) to a subsequent reactor where at least a portion of the monoaryl dihalophosphate is recycled to the first reactor for reaction with the phenol contained therein to form additional diaryl halophosphate in the first reactor and the reaction mixture in (b) becomes enriched with diaryl halophosphate to ultimately favor the ultimate formation of a product of lower molecular weight distribution; and (c) reacting the product from (a) or (b), as selected, with an aromatic diol to form the arylene poly(diarylphosphate) product.
    芳基聚(二芳基磷酸酯)组合物可通过以下工艺形成: (a) 在第一反应器中,通过氧卤化磷和苯酚的反应,形成一种反应混合物,该混合物包括卤磷酸二芳基酯,以及作为副产品的二卤磷酸单芳基酯和磷酸三芳基酯的混合物; (b) 如果希望低聚物占优势,可选择将(a)中的反应混合物转移到后续反应器中,在后续 反应器中,至少一部分二卤代磷酸单芳基酯被回收到第一反应器中,与其中的苯酚反 应,在第一反应器中形成额外的卤代磷酸二芳基酯,(b)中的反应混合物富含卤代磷酸二 芳基酯,最终有利于形成分子量分布较低的产品;以及 (c) 将(a)或(b)中选出的产物与芳香族二元醇反应,形成芳基聚二芳基磷酸酯产物。
  • Purification method of phosphoric esters
    申请人:DAIHACHI CHEMICAL INDUSTRY CO., LTD.
    公开号:EP0690063A1
    公开(公告)日:1996-01-03
    A purification method of a phosphoric ester, which comprises treating a crude phosphoric ester with an epoxy compound, heating the resultant in the presence of water, washing the resultant with water, and removing the residual water. The obtained phosphoric esters have low acid value and are excellent in physical properties such as heat resistance, resistance to hydrolysis and storage stability, and are useful as plasticizers and/or flame-retardants.
    一种磷酸酯的提纯方法,包括用环氧化合物处理粗磷酸酯,在有水的情况下加热所得产物,用水洗涤所得产物,然后除去残留的水。得到的磷酸酯酸值低,物理性能优异,如耐热性、抗水解性和储存稳定性,可用作增塑剂和/或阻燃剂。
